Editor’s Update Wednesday Feb 3rd 4:30 PM: The car involved in the crash was a Hyundai Elantra and not a Kia. Everett Police provided the following new details today.
Traffic detectives continue investigating a serious injury collision on SE Everett Mall Way in Everett.Just after 4:30 p.m. yesterday, officers responded to reports of a collision involving multiple vehicles blocking the 300 block of SE Everett Mall Way. Arriving officers found several injured people and one of the involved vehicles had struck and sheared off a utility pole.
Traffic detectives responded to the scene. Based on their initial investigation and witness accounts, detectives believe a female was test driving a Hyundai Elantra. She was driving recklessly on northbound SE Everett Mall Way and rear-ended a Chevy Silverado which had just completed a right turn onto Everett Mall Way. The impact pushed the Silverado across the intersection, through a utility pole and into the parking lot of 316 SE Everett Mall Way where it came to rest on its side. A third vehicle, unoccupied and parked at the business, was struck by the utility pole.
The Elantra’s driver, a 42 year-old female, and the male passenger, a 39 year-old employee of an auto dealership, were both transported to Providence Regional Medical Center Everett with serious and potentially life-threatening injuries. No medical updates will be provided.
The driver of the Silverado, a 54 year-old man, and his 10 year-old daughter were treated at the scene for minor injuries and released. There were no injuries associated with the third vehicle.
Traffic detectives continue investigating the incident and believe speed was a factor in the collision.
The 300 block of SE Everett Mall Way was closed for almost three hours while detectives processed the scene.
